Wax myrtle
Morella
Wax myrtle (Morella) is a genus of evergreen or deciduous shrubs and small trees belonging to the Myricaceae family. These plants are notable for their ability to fix atmospheric nitrogen through a symbiotic relationship with actinomycetes, enabling them to thrive in nutrient-poor soils.

Wax myrtle
The plants generally require full sun to partial shade for optimal development. They are particularly well-suited to acidic, well-draining soils but demonstrate remarkable tolerance to various soil types, including sandy and saline coastal areas.
Climate requirements vary by species, but most prefer temperate regions. They are highly valued for their resilience against wind and salt spray, making them ideal for landscaping and soil stabilization projects.
Cultivation practices involve regular mulching to maintain soil moisture levels and suppress weed growth. Pruning is essential to manage the plant's shape and encourage dense, healthy foliage, especially when grown as a hedge.
Economically, Morella species are used for their edible berries, aromatic leaves, and the wax coating on their fruit, which has historically been harvested for candle making and culinary flavorings.
While generally hardy, wax myrtle can be susceptible to fungal leaf spots when grown in environments with poor air circulation or excessive humidity.
Pests such as scale insects and aphids may occasionally infest the plants, particularly during the active growth phases in late spring and summer.
Root rot is a significant risk in waterlogged soil conditions. Ensuring proper site drainage is the most effective preventative measure against such diseases.
Monitoring for signs of chlorosis is important, as the plant's iron uptake can be affected if the soil pH becomes too high for the specific species.
Integrated pest management strategies are recommended to maintain plant health while avoiding the overuse of synthetic chemicals on edible crops.
